**Action item PM-2241: Metrics sidecar backpressure**

Owner to add backpressure handling to the Copperline metrics-aggregation sidecar so that bursts above 50k points per second are buffered rather than dropped silently, as occurred during the Grayharbor incident. Reviewer should confirm the buffer is bounded and that drops emit a counter. Design rationale and sizing math are captured on the page below.

wiki page, tahaf-tajog: https://jira.ordindyn.corp/pipeline

Handover — Delmore Office Closure

For J. Brightwell, incoming.

Delmore site closes end of quarter. Lease notice served; landlord acknowledged. Eleven staff: six relocating to Kestwick, three remote, two severance packages pending sign-off. IT decommission booked. Keep the closure quiet until the all-hands — Arlena is handling comms. Final walkthrough is your job. The wider rationale for this move is summarised in the note below.

confidential, kagup-bafog: Fraaxax Group is in early talks to buy Soroxox Group for about $343.8 million. The Olidor launch date is June 14, and nothing goes to the press before then. Legal wants the Aldmirek Logistics term sheet signed before July 23.

**☐ Sort out bike cage + parking access for the new starter**

Before their first morning at Brindleworth House, make sure they know the bike cage is round the back past the Tollam Street gates — it fills up fast, so tell them to arrive before 8:30 if they're cycling. The car park gates open automatically on exit but need a code on entry. Add them to the Fennick parking list, then share the current gate code below.

turnstile pass: bdg-QZV-3

## Changelog — Ticktrace 1.9

### Renamed: DRIFT_API_TOKEN
During the cron drift investigation we found plugins confusing this variable with the metrics token, so it has been renamed to indicate it authorizes drift-report uploads specifically. Plugin authors must read the new name from 1.9 onward; the old name is ignored without warning. Sample env files in the SDK are updated. In your deployment env file, the drift-report upload secret is set on the next line.

env line for fawef-taguf: VAULT_KEY13=a9695905a9a90